Quick Assessment

This delightful collection of poems introduces young readers to the colors of the spectrum through vivid imagery and playful language. Suitable for early readers aged 5 to 8, the book encourages sensory exploration and appreciation of nature and everyday experiences. It is a gentle and creative way to support literacy and artistic expression without any challenging content.
